Why Personal Branding for Consultants Matters? 

1. Differentiation: Clients have countless options when choosing a consultant in a crowded market. A strong personal brand sets you apart from the competition by highlighting your expertise, strengths, experiences, and problem-solving approach.

2. Credibility & Trust: A well-crafted personal brand enhances your credibility and establishes you as an authority in your field. Consistently delivering valuable insights, content, and results reinforces client trust and positions you as a trusted advisor. Statistics show that 92% of B2B buyers consider a consultant’s credibility a deciding factor. 

3. Client Attraction: A compelling personal brand attracts clients who resonate with your values, expertise, and vision. By effectively communicating your unique selling proposition (USP), you can attract the right clients who are willing to invest in your services.

4. Career Advancement: A strong personal brand can open doors to new opportunities, including speaking engagements, media features, and collaborations with other industry experts. It also enhances your professional reputation and increases your visibility within your niche.

Consultant Personal Branding Steps

1. Find Your Niche & Value Proposition: Consultants often wear many hats. Identify your area of expertise and the specific value you deliver to clients. What problem do you solve exceptionally well?

2. Craft Your Brand Story: People connect with stories. Develop a compelling narrative that showcases your expertise, experience, and passion for your field.

3. Content is King: Become a go-to resource for valuable industry knowledge. Publish articles on relevant platforms like LinkedIn or start your blog.

Example: Let’s say you’re a consultant specializing in social media marketing for e-commerce businesses. You could write blog posts on the latest social media trends for e-commerce or share case studies of your past successes.

4. Leverage Social Media: Actively participate in industry discussions on platforms like Twitter and LinkedIn. Engage with potential clients, share your content, and join relevant groups.

Pro Tip: Don’t just broadcast – be interactive! Respond to comments, answer questions, and build relationships with other professionals.

5. Speak at Industry Events: Public speaking positions you as an expert and allows you to connect with a broader audience. Volunteer for speaking opportunities at conferences, events or webinars related to your niche.

6. Build Strategic Partnerships: Collaborate with other consultants or businesses. Cross-promotion can expand your reach and introduce you to new potential clients.
